    Generalized REL property
    
    Using regex to match multiple forms of REL. For example 'in-front' 'in
    front of' and 'in front' will all be standardized as 'in front of'.

+(defun boxy-headings--get-rel (&optional pos)
+  "Get the boxy relationship from an org heading at POS.
+
+POS can be nil to use the heading at point.
+
+The default relationship is 'in'."
+  (let ((rel (org-entry-get pos "REL")))
+    (cond
+     ((not rel)
+      "in")
+     ((string-match-p "on.+top" rel)
+      "on top of")
+     ((string-match-p "in.+front" rel)
+      "in front of")
+     ((string-match-p "behind" rel)
+      "behind")
+     ((string-match-p "above" rel)
+      "above")
+     ((string-match-p "below" rel)
+      "below")
+     ((string-match-p "left" rel)
+      "to the left of")
+     ((string-match-p "right" rel)
+      "to the right of")
+     (t
+      "in"))))
